In today’s competitive digital landscape, mobile applications are no longer optional—they are essential for businesses looking to engage users, increase revenue, and strengthen brand presence. With billions of Android devices in use worldwide, the platform presents unparalleled opportunities for businesses to reach their target audience effectively. However, creating a successful Android app requires more than just technical knowledge; it demands strategic planning, user-centric design, scalability, and continuous optimization. This is precisely why partnering with an Android app development agency is a strategic choice for startups, SMEs, and large enterprises alike.
An Android app development agency specializes in building tailored mobile solutions that meet the unique needs of businesses. Unlike generic app builders or in-house teams with limited experience, these agencies bring expertise in cutting-edge technologies, design thinking, and industry best practices to create solutions that are not only functional but also engaging and scalable. For companies seeking specialized local expertise combined with global standards, a mobile app development company in Austin or a trusted mobile application development agency offers the perfect blend of professionalism, innovation, and reliability.
In this guide, we’ll explore why businesses should choose an Android app development agency for custom solutions, how such agencies operate, and the key benefits they provide for startups and enterprises.
The Importance of Custom Mobile Solutions
Businesses today operate in a dynamic environment where user expectations are constantly evolving. Pre-built app templates may provide a quick solution, but they often fall short when it comes to meeting specific business requirements, delivering exceptional user experience, or integrating seamlessly with existing systems. Custom mobile solutions, on the other hand, are tailored to the business’s unique goals, ensuring that the app becomes a strategic tool rather than just a digital product.
Custom solutions allow businesses to:
-
Enhance User Experience: Tailored interfaces and workflows ensure that the app aligns perfectly with user expectations, increasing engagement and retention.
-
Integrate with Existing Systems: Enterprises often require apps that connect seamlessly with CRMs, ERPs, databases, and third-party platforms.
-
Scale with Business Growth: Custom apps are built with scalability in mind, allowing features, users, and integrations to expand without performance degradation.
-
Ensure Competitive Advantage: Unique features and designs differentiate your app from competitors, strengthening brand identity and market position.
Choosing an Android app development agency ensures that your custom solution is carefully crafted to meet these objectives, leveraging both technical expertise and industry insight.
Why an Android App Development Agency Is Essential
Partnering with an Android app development agency offers multiple advantages compared to attempting app development in-house or using generic solutions:
Technical Expertise and Experience
Android app development involves diverse technologies, from Kotlin and Java to Jetpack, Firebase, and cloud-based architectures. Experienced agencies stay updated with the latest trends, ensuring that your app leverages cutting-edge features such as AI integration, AR/VR, and real-time analytics.
A mobile application development agency also understands the nuances of app architecture, backend development, and API integration, ensuring that the app is robust, secure, and scalable. For companies in Austin or other tech hubs, a mobile app development company in Austin can provide localized support combined with global standards.
End-to-End Development
An Android app development agency offers complete end-to-end services—from requirement analysis and UX/UI design to development, testing, deployment, and maintenance. Startups benefit from rapid MVP development, while enterprises enjoy comprehensive solutions that integrate seamlessly with existing workflows and systems.
Time and Cost Efficiency
Building an in-house development team requires recruitment, training, and infrastructure costs. Partnering with an Android app development agency saves both time and resources, providing access to a full team of experts who can deliver high-quality apps within defined timelines.
Access to Industry Best Practices
Agencies have worked on diverse projects across industries, giving them valuable insight into what works and what doesn’t. This experience ensures that your custom solution adheres to industry best practices in usability, performance, security, and compliance.
How Android App Development Agencies Approach Custom Solutions
A mobile application development agency typically follows a structured approach to ensure that each custom solution is aligned with business goals and user expectations.
1. Requirement Gathering and Analysis
The first step involves understanding your business objectives, target audience, and desired features. Agencies collaborate with stakeholders to define clear goals, identify potential challenges, and create a roadmap for development. This stage ensures that the app is tailored to meet your unique business requirements.
2. UX/UI Design
Design is critical for user engagement. An Android app development agency focuses on creating intuitive interfaces and seamless workflows that enhance the user experience. Wireframes, prototypes, and iterative design feedback ensure that the final product is both visually appealing and functionally effective.
3. Backend and API Development
A custom app requires a scalable and secure backend. Agencies design APIs, databases, and server architecture that support current needs while allowing for future growth. This ensures that the app can handle increasing users, data volume, and integrations without performance issues.
4. Frontend Development
Frontend development focuses on creating interactive and responsive app interfaces. Using modern frameworks and technologies, agencies develop apps that are fast, reliable, and visually consistent across devices.
5. Testing and Quality Assurance
Testing is vital to ensure app reliability and user satisfaction. Agencies conduct rigorous testing across multiple devices, Android versions, and usage scenarios. Automated testing and continuous integration help identify issues early and maintain high-quality standards.
6. Deployment and Post-Launch Support
After development, the app is deployed to the Google Play Store. Post-launch maintenance, updates, and performance optimization are essential for long-term success. A mobile application development agency ensures continuous support, bug fixes, and feature updates to keep the app relevant and efficient.
Benefits for Startups
For startups, working with an Android app development agency provides unique advantages:
-
Rapid MVP Development: Agencies focus on core features to launch quickly and validate market response.
-
Scalable Architecture: Apps are built to support rapid growth without major redesigns.
-
Data-Driven Insights: Analytics tools provide insights into user behavior, guiding future iterations.
-
Cross-Platform Readiness: Frameworks and design principles allow future expansion to other platforms.
A mobile application development agency ensures that startup apps are cost-effective, innovative, and ready for fast-paced market adoption.
Benefits for Enterprises
Enterprises face unique challenges that require robust, secure, and scalable solutions:
-
Integration with Business Systems: Connect apps seamlessly with ERPs, CRMs, and other internal tools.
-
Security and Compliance: Ensure end-to-end encryption, secure authentication, and adherence to GDPR, HIPAA, or other regulations.
-
Scalability: Handle thousands of users simultaneously without performance issues.
-
Advanced Features: Multi-role access, analytics dashboards, AI-powered recommendations, and real-time reporting.
A mobile app development company in Austin or a dedicated Android app development agency helps enterprises achieve these objectives while delivering a seamless user experience.
Cost-Effectiveness and Engagement Models
Cost is a major consideration when developing custom solutions. Agencies offer flexible engagement models to suit different needs:
-
Fixed-Price Model: Ideal for projects with well-defined requirements.
-
Time and Material: Suitable for evolving projects with changing requirements.
-
Dedicated Team: Best for long-term collaboration, particularly for enterprise-scale solutions.
Partnering with a mobile application development agency ensures a balance between cost, quality, and time-to-market, providing measurable ROI.
Trends Shaping Android App Development
Experienced agencies leverage future-ready technologies to keep your app competitive:
-
Artificial Intelligence and Machine Learning: Personalization, predictive analytics, and automation.
-
Internet of Things (IoT) Integration: Apps connected to smart devices and sensors for enhanced functionality.
-
Augmented Reality (AR) and Virtual Reality (VR): Immersive experiences for gaming, retail, and education.
-
Cloud-Native Solutions: Elastic scalability, global accessibility, and high performance.
-
Progressive Web Apps (PWA): Hybrid solutions with offline functionality and faster loading.
By adopting these trends, a mobile app development company in Austin or a mobile application development agency ensures that your custom app remains competitive, scalable, and innovative.
Conclusion
In today’s mobile-first world, businesses cannot afford to compromise on quality, user experience, or scalability. Choosing an Android app development agency for custom solutions provides startups and enterprises with the expertise, strategic guidance, and technical capabilities needed to build high-performing apps.
A mobile application development agency or mobile app development company in Austin offers end-to-end services—from requirement analysis and UX/UI design to backend development, deployment, and ongoing maintenance. By focusing on scalability, performance, security, and innovation, these agencies ensure that your custom Android app not only meets current business needs but is also prepared for future growth.
Partnering with an experienced Android app development agency is not just a development decision—it is a strategic investment in the long-term success of your digital products. Whether you are a startup testing a new concept or an enterprise looking to enhance operational efficiency, a professional agency ensures that your mobile solutions are impactful, scalable, and tailored to your business objectives.